THE FILTER FACTORY's Details

FILTERS CLOTH > THE FILTER FACTORY
Current Image

Category: FILTERS CLOTH

Name: THE FILTER FACTORY

Address: LL-2,Avani Plaza, Nr.Satellite Tower, Sa

Phone Number: 9825175934

Email: inquiry.tff@gmail.com

City: AHEMDABAD

Back to List

Contact Seller